ALL THE REDS, BLUES, AND GREENS

Ancient Egyptian painters left us millions of colourful objects, but no writings about their trade. Consequently, we are left relying on archaeology to learn about painting in ancient Egypt. What pigments did they use which could stay bright for thousands of years? How can we identify them today?

SPECIAL PAINTING AND PIGMENTS IN ANCIENT EGYPT The study of ancient pigments developed with the modern science of chemistry. Already in the eighteenth century, the discovery of paintings and cakes of pigment at Pompeii inspired investigations of ancient pigments. Researchers today can use a variety of destructive and nondestructive techniques to analyze Egyptian pigments. Flakes of paint can be examined under a microscope to discern the individual grains of pigment. The same flakes can be placed in a scanning electron microscope that launches beams of electrons at them, which can magnify an image more than optical microscopes.
